Near BTM 2nd Stage, BTM Layout, Bengaluru South Zone, Bengaluru
Near BTM 2nd Stage, BTM Layout, Bengaluru South Zone, Bengaluru
284, 7th Main Road, Bengaluru, 560076
Near BTM 2nd Stage, BTM Layout, Bengaluru South Zone, Bengaluru
37/1, 16th Main Road, Bangalore, 560076
107, 7th Main Road, Bangalore, 560076
Near BTM 2nd Stage, BTM Layout, Bengaluru South Zone, Bengaluru
Commerce @ Mantri, Bannerghatta Road
55/373/2, BTM layout, Bengaluru, 560076
Bannerghatta Road, Bengaluru, 560076
Near BTM 2nd Stage, BTM Layout, Bengaluru South Zone, Bengaluru